C#.net Winform自定义系统开发及数据库配置教程
版权申诉
2星 145 浏览量
更新于2024-10-11
收藏 2.83MB ZIP 举报
资源摘要信息:"C#.NET WinForm 自定义系统简单版"
本资源提供了一个基于C#语言开发的.NET WinForms应用程序的简单版自定义系统。该系统旨在通过用户友好的界面来简化模块化数据录入的过程,允许用户创建自定义模块,自动生成相关数据表,以及相应的导航菜单和界面。用户还可以在这些自动生成的模块上执行基础的数据库操作,包括增加、删除、修改和查询数据(增删改查)。以下详细说明了此系统包含的关键知识点。
**WinForm 应用程序开发**
WinForm 是.NET Framework中用于开发桌面应用程序的一个类库,它提供了一套丰富的控件,可以用来创建Windows桌面应用程序。在该系统中,WinForm 被用来构建用户界面,使得非技术用户也能够通过图形化界面进行数据操作。
**模块化设计**
系统支持自定义模块的录入,这意味着用户可以根据需要创建新的模块,每创建一个新模块,系统会自动生成对应的数据表和界面。模块化设计使得系统的扩展和维护变得更加容易,也方便了功能的添加和变更。
**数据表的动态生成**
系统能够根据用户定义的模块自动创建数据表。这通常涉及到动态SQL语句的执行,根据输入的模块信息构建数据表结构,并存储到数据库中。
**导航菜单与界面生成**
系统能够为每个创建的模块自动生成导航菜单项和操作界面。这通常通过读取配置信息或者模块定义来动态生成用户界面组件。
**增删改查操作**
基本的数据库操作(增删改查,CRUD)是该系统的核心功能之一。开发者通过编写相应的代码逻辑来实现对数据库的简单操作,通常会用到***或者Entity Framework等.NET数据访问技术。
**数据库备份与还原**
DataBase文件夹中存放的SQL BAK文件是SQL Server数据库的备份文件。这允许用户将系统数据库备份到BAK文件中,并在需要时还原到SQL Server数据库中。
**配置文件的使用**
系统的配置信息,例如数据库的地址、账户名和密码,通常存储在配置文件如richdataconfiguration.config中。通过修改配置文件,用户可以改变系统连接数据库的参数,而不必修改源代码。
**系统源代码提供**
资源的描述中提到,最终会提供系统的源代码。这为开发者提供了一个学习和理解系统实现细节的机会,同时也方便了后期的维护和功能扩展。
**标签**
标签指明了该资源的主要技术栈,包括C#语言、.NET平台、WinForm 应用程序开发以及SQL数据库。这些是开发类似系统时必须掌握的关键技术。
**文件名称列表**
文件名称列表中的"自定义系统"表明了压缩包中可能包含了系统的所有文件,包括项目文件、配置文件、数据库备份文件等。
以上对C#.NET WinForm 自定义系统简单版的知识点进行了详细的说明,覆盖了从系统设计到实现的关键方面。该资源为希望学习如何构建类似系统的开发者提供了实用的参考。
2009-02-17 上传
2019-02-24 上传
2012-08-04 上传
2013-12-02 上传
2008-12-26 上传
2010-04-24 上传
2023-02-04 上传
点击了解资源详情
CSICSICSICSI
- 粉丝: 13
- 资源: 61
最新资源
- 全国江河水系图层shp文件包下载
- 点云二值化测试数据集的详细解读
- JDiskCat:跨平台开源磁盘目录工具
- 加密FS模块:实现动态文件加密的Node.js包
- 宠物小精灵记忆配对游戏:强化你的命名记忆
- React入门教程:创建React应用与脚本使用指南
- Linux和Unix文件标记解决方案:贝岭的matlab代码
- Unity射击游戏UI套件:支持C#与多种屏幕布局
- MapboxGL Draw自定义模式:高效切割多边形方法
- C语言课程设计:计算机程序编辑语言的应用与优势
- 吴恩达课程手写实现Python优化器和网络模型
- PFT_2019项目:ft_printf测试器的新版测试规范
- MySQL数据库备份Shell脚本使用指南
- Ohbug扩展实现屏幕录像功能
- Ember CLI 插件:ember-cli-i18n-lazy-lookup 实现高效国际化
- Wireshark网络调试工具:中文支持的网口发包与分析